About Blue Federal Credit Union
Blue Federal Credit Union was originally chartered in 1951 as Warren Federal Credit Union by a group of civilian personnel at F.E. Warren Air Force Base, located in the Cheyenne, Wyoming, area.
For the following 70-plus years, the organization has transformed through expansion, successful mergers and an ever-growing membership base to become a financial institution that today is all about empowering people to tap into the potential of their money, life and community.
“Blue” nods not only to Air Force Blue, but also to a deep connection to the Rockies, to limitless open skies — and to a promise of financial opportunity that’s equally boundless.

Think of a no-penalty CD as a better version than a traditional certificate of deposit. Like its name suggests, a no-penalty CD does not impose early withdrawal penalties if you need to tap your savings before the term is complete.
No-penalty CDs aka liquid CDs, offers considerable liquidity by allowing you access to your deposited funds at anytime, with no penalty! While no-penalty CDs typically offer lower rates than fixed-term CDs, they still provide a higher rate than most regular savings accounts.
If you do need to break up your no-penalty CD before the term is over, you’ll have to take out its full value. You also cannot make incremental, top-up deposits after the first purchase.
